What you'll work on

Course Curriculum

01

Why Cleaning Matters

Understand how fouling, carbon buildup, and lack of lubrication affect your handgun's reliability and accuracy — and why regular maintenance is part of responsible ownership.

Fouling & carbon buildup

Reliability impact

Cleaning frequency

Manufacturer recommendations

02

Field Stripping

Learn to safely disassemble your handgun into its major components for cleaning — without tools, without guesswork. We cover the process for both semi-automatics and revolvers.

Safe unloading

Semi-auto field strip

Revolver breakdown

Component identification

03

Cleaning the Action & Slide

Remove carbon and fouling from the slide, frame rails, and action components — the areas that affect feeding, extraction, and overall function most directly.

Slide rails

Frame cleaning

Extractor & ejector

Carbon removal

04

Lubrication

Too much oil is as problematic as too little. Learn exactly where to apply lubricant, how much to use, and which products work best for your specific firearm.

Lubrication points

Oil vs. grease

Product selection

Over-lubrication issues

05

Reassembly & Function Check

Reassemble your handgun correctly and perform a function check to confirm everything is working as it should before you leave the class.

Correct reassembly sequence

Function check

Common reassembly errors

Inspection tips
